Light Cone
Lies Dance on the BreezeAt 170 SPD, Welt activates the cone's second DEF-reduction effect and maintains fast, teamwide support through frequent attacks.
When to use it : Welt must have at least 170 SPD out of combat.
Relics
With an Ultimate every two to three actions, the action advance produces more turns, debuffs and Energy than a conventional damage set for support Welt.
Planar Ornaments
Energy regeneration helps maintain the Ultimate's delay and DEF reduction, while the first-slot Ashveil receives its ATK bonus.
Team lineup
Ashveil rewards frequent allied attacks and layered debuffs, Welt supplies both, Sunday adds actions and Energy, and Aventurine sustains while attacking often.

Welt slows targets, delays their actions and uses his Ultimate to impose Imprisonment and teamwide DEF reduction while still contributing damage.
How to play it
- 1Attack to establish the cone's DEF reductions before allied damage lands.
- 2Use the Skill when its multi-hit Slow and Energy are worth a Skill Point; otherwise use Basic ATK.
- 3Cast the Ultimate immediately after an enemy finishes its turn to maximize the distance of the delay.
